Louisiana Revised Statutes Tit. 33, § 5052. Enforcement of requirements

All clerks and ex-officio recorders and notaries public in all the parishes, the parish of Orleans excepted, shall refuse to place on record any deeds of sale of property to which R.S. 33:5051 applies until the provisions of R.S. 33:5051 have been complied with.  They shall report to the district attorney all violations thereof coming within their knowledge.
